What causes one pupil to dialate while the other is normal, im not on drugs and havnt used eye drops??


Question: only one of my eyes will dialate and i cant feel it or i dont have unusual sensations because of it, people have pointed it out to me and now it is scareing me, please help.
Answers: It's called anisocoria. It can be completely normal. Or you could have glaucoma, a tumor, or some type of poisoning. See your eyedoctor.

* Simple anisocoria

o Simple anisocoria may be found in up to 20% of the general population and may vary from day to day in the same individual.

o In most patients, the degree of anisocoria is less than 1 mm, and no ptosis, dilation lag, or vasomotor dysfunction is present.

o In some patients, simple anisocoria may be provoked by oral medications (eg, pseudoephedrine, sel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ors).

o Instillation of 4-10% cocaine solution causes dilation of both eyes.

o Old photographs, sometimes from drivers' licenses, can provide evidence that the anisocoria has been present for some time.
